Brzustewicz had 92 pts in 67 OHL GP, and Parekh had 96 pts in 66 OHL GP, so just a slight edge in points, and both are RH. Couple questions for those who follow prospects:
Between those two D-men, everyone seems WAY more excited for Parekh. Is it because Parekh posted those stats at a younger age, had way more goals, and has an agitator element to his game that Brzustewicz doesn't have? Or, are there other factors? How much separation is there between the two?
|
Parekh’s skating and hands are on another level from Brzustewicz.

Shaping up really nicely:
x - Parekh
Morin - Brzustewicz
Poirier - x
Yeah, good look defending that NHL if these guys hit. That's fantastic puck-moving and play-driving. The two x's are probably already covered. Flames don't need a #1 defencemen any longer, though they might still find one in this or future drafts. They need a reliable partner to pair with Parekh unless Morin (who I think is the 2nd best defensive prospect on the Flames) can be that guy. They have a lot of what I would call capable defensive guys in the system. Flames are flush now with very good defencemen.
That's a really good looking group. I didn't include Weegar, Andersson or Kylington here, though some or all may be around still. Grushnikov, Miromanov, Bahl, Pachal, etc., etc. - these are all guys who can take some of the x's in the future.
Flames are really building a fairly lethal, modern, puck-moving defensive corps. I really like it.
